Variety or Cultivar 'Snowdrift' _ 'Snowdrift' is a mat-forming, evergreen subshrub with small, aromatic, dark green leaves and clusters of white flowers in summer. Different from every other thyme, 'Elfin' grows as tiny, tight buns of dark green, often bronzed leaves and carries small heads of rosy pink flowers in summer - sometimes not too freely, but it's a wonderful wee foliage plant even without flowers. White flowered thyme has lovely green foliage, whilst Doone Valley has bright gold and green variegations, and creeping red thyme produces bronze hues in the autumn and winter. Variety or Cultivar 'Elfin' _ 'Elfin' is an evergreen subshrub forming dense mounds of finely hairy, trailing stems bearing tiny, linear to elliptic, aromatic, grey-green leaves and whorls of small, two-lipped, lilac-pink flowers in summer. While the plants being sold as creeping thyme or elfin thyme are quite similar in growth habit and produce lovely little flowers, it might be helpful to know which is which before investing in one or more of these charming herbal plants. Some of the best types of thyme for a thyme lawn are Thymus serpyllum 'Elfin' (Elfin thyme), Thymus coccineus (Red Creeping thyme) and Thymus pseudolanuginosus (Wooly thyme).
